Brodit Holder for Apple iPhone 15 Pro Max | Brodit

+ clip is needed:
Brodit ProClip Mount for Skoda Octavia III | Brodit

 

Have Brodit system for years- super quality and nothing bounces. + Free access to both central air vents and emergency signal button.
ProClip (specifically made for exact car) idea is super- various types of Brodit holders can be attached.
Yes, it's not cheap- but it will be last phone holder you'll need.
